What Exactly is CLA Parking Assist?

What Exactly is CLA Parking Assist?

CLA Parking Assist refers to a suite of advanced driver-assistance systems (ADAS) in your Mercedes-Benz CLA that help automate or simplify the parking process. These systems typically combine sensors (radar and ultrasonic) located around the vehicle’s bumpers with cameras strategically placed on the exterior. Their primary goal is to detect suitable parking spaces and then skillfully guide the vehicle into them, either fully automatically or with minimal driver intervention. This technology is designed to enhance convenience and safety, reducing the risk of minor collisions that can often occur during parking maneuvers.

How CLA Parking Assist Works: The Technology Behind the Magic

How CLA Parking Assist Works: The Technology Behind the Magic

At its core, CLA Parking Assist relies on a network of sensors and cameras that constantly scan the surroundings of your vehicle. Think of them as your car’s eyes and ears, diligently searching for parking opportunities and monitoring distances to other vehicles and obstacles.

The Role of Sensors

Your CLA is equipped with multiple ultrasonic sensors, often subtly integrated into the front and rear bumpers. These sensors emit high-frequency sound waves and measure the time it takes for them to bounce back after hitting an object. This allows the system to accurately gauge the distance between your car and surrounding vehicles, curbs, or walls. The precision of these sensors is crucial for identifying whether a space is large enough and for maintaining safe clearance during the parking maneuver.

The Importance of Cameras

In addition to sensors, many CLA models feature rearview and surround-view cameras. The rearview camera provides a visual feed of what’s directly behind your car when you’re in reverse, displaying it on the central infotainment screen. Surround-view cameras, also known as 360-degree cameras, use multiple cameras (front, rear, and side mirrors) to create a bird’s-eye view of your vehicle and its immediate surroundings. This composite image is incredibly useful for navigating tight spaces, allowing you to see exactly where your wheels are in relation to painted lines or obstacles.

The Brain of the Operation: The ECU

All the data collected by the sensors and cameras is processed by a sophisticated Electronic Control Unit (ECU). This “brain” analyzes the information to identify potential parking spaces, calculate the optimal trajectory for entering the space, and control key vehicle functions like steering, acceleration, and braking (depending on the specific parking assist level). This integration allows for smooth and precise automated movements.

Types of CLA Parking Assist Features

Types of CLA Parking Assist Features

Mercedes-Benz offers various levels of parking assistance across its CLA models and model years. Understanding these distinctions will help you utilize the features best suited to your driving experience.

Active Park Assist

This is the most comprehensive parking assistance system. When activated, Active Park Assist can take over the steering and, in many cases, the acceleration and braking to guide your CLA into both parallel and perpendicular parking spots. The driver remains responsible for monitoring the surroundings and using the pedals as needed (or as prompted by the system). The system typically identifies suitable spaces as you drive past them and alerts you to their availability.

Parking Pilot

Often used interchangeably with Active Park Assist, the term “Parking Pilot” generally refers to systems that actively steer the vehicle into a parking space. Depending on the specific package and model year, it may also manage throttle and braking. It’s designed to handle the complex steering angles required, making it ideal for situations where manual steering would be challenging.

Rear-View Camera

A standard or widely available feature, the rear-view camera provides a clear image of the area behind your car on the infotainment display when you shift into reverse. While it doesn’t actively steer or control the vehicle, it significantly enhances your awareness of obstacles, making backing up much safer and easier. It’s a foundational tool for confident parking.

PARKTRONIC with Active Parking Assist

This designation signifies that your CLA combines PARKTRONIC visual and audible warnings with the automated steering capabilities of Active Park Assist. PARKTRONIC uses sensors to detect obstacles and warns you with beeps and visual indicators on the dashboard display. When combined with Active Park Assist, it offers a hands-off steering experience for parking, with the PARKTRONIC sensors ensuring you don’t get too close to anything.

How to Use CLA Parking Assist: A Step-by-Step Guide

How to Use CLA Parking Assist: A Step-by-Step Guide

Using your CLA’s parking assist system is designed to be intuitive. Here’s a general step-by-step guide that applies to most models equipped with Active Park Assist. Always refer to your vehicle’s owner’s manual for precise instructions tailored to your specific CLA.

Step 1: Activate the System

Locate the parking assist button, often found on the center console or integrated into the dashboard. Pressing this button typically activates the search function for parking spaces.

Step 2: Search for a Parking Space

While driving at a low speed (usually below 30 km/h or 20 mph) and keeping to the side of the road where you want to park, the system will actively scan for suitable parking spots. Look for an indicator on your dashboard or infotainment screen that shows the system is searching. The system will typically display “Search is active” or a similar message.

Step 3: Identify a Suitable Space

When the system detects a parking space that meets its criteria (size, angle, etc.), it will alert you. This often involves a message on the display, such as “Parking space found,” and an audible chime. The system will usually indicate on which side of the vehicle the space was detected.

Step 4: Select Parking Mode

Once a space is identified, you will need to confirm your choice and select the type of parking (parallel or perpendicular). The system will then prompt you to shift into the appropriate gear (Reverse for backing in, Drive for pulling in if applicable). You may also need to indicate which side you want to park on if the system detected a space on multiple sides.

Step 5: Initiate the Maneuver

Follow the on-screen instructions. You will typically need to keep your hands near the steering wheel (as the system may only control the steering initially) and control the accelerator and brake pedals. The system will now take over the steering, guiding the car into the parking spot. You will hear beeps and see visual cues as the car gets closer to surrounding objects.

Step 6: Monitor and Control

Continuously monitor the surroundings. The system will guide you through the maneuver, advising you when to change gears or to apply the brakes. If at any point you feel uncomfortable or need to stop, simply grab the steering wheel firmly or press the brake pedal. The system will disengage, returning control to you.

Step 7: Complete the Maneuver

The system will continue to guide your CLA until it is safely parked. Once the maneuver is complete, the display will usually indicate “Parking complete” or a similar message, and the system will disengage. You can then take full control, adjust your position slightly if needed, and turn off the engine.

Using the Rear-View Camera and PARKTRONIC

Using the Rear-View Camera and PARKTRONIC

Even if your CLA doesn’t have full Active Park Assist, the rear-view camera and PARKTRONIC sensors are invaluable parking aids. Here’s how to maximize their use:

Rear-View Camera Usage

Activation: Simply shift your CLA into reverse. The camera feed will automatically appear on the central display.
Interpreting the Display: You’ll see the area directly behind your vehicle. Many systems include dynamic guidelines that change color or trajectory based on your steering wheel’s current position, showing you where your car will turn. Use these as a guide for steering and judging distances.
Complementary Use: Always use your mirrors and look over your shoulder in conjunction with the camera. The camera provides a wide view but doesn’t replace your direct senses.

PARKTRONIC Sensor Usage

Detection: PARKTRONIC sensors, usually visible as small dots on the bumpers, activate automatically when you’re in low-speed forward or reverse gears.
Auditory Cues: As you approach an obstacle, you’ll hear a series of beeps. The closer you get, the faster the beeping becomes, transitioning from intermittent to a continuous tone when you are very close.
Visual Cues: The dashboard display will typically show a graphic representation of your vehicle and indications of how many sensors are detecting objects, along with colored bars or lights that change from green to yellow to red as proximity decreases.
Safety Stops: In some models, PARKTRONIC can automatically apply the brakes if it detects an imminent collision, preventing or mitigating damage.
Combined Power: Use PARKTRONIC in conjunction with your rear-view camera and mirrors. The beeps provide a tangible warning that you might not see on the screen, especially for low-lying objects or objects off to the side.

Best Practices for CLA Parking Assist

To get the most out of your CLA’s parking assistance features and ensure safety, follow these best practices:

  • Read Your Owner’s Manual: Every CLA model and trim can have slightly different functionalities and operating procedures. Your owner’s manual is the definitive guide for your specific vehicle.
  • Familiarize Yourself in a Safe Space: Practice using the system in a large, empty parking lot before attempting it in a crowded street. This builds your confidence and understanding of how the system behaves.
  • Maintain Low Speeds: Parking assist systems are designed to operate at very low speeds. Driving too fast can cause the system to disengage or not function correctly.
  • Always Stay Alert: Parking assist is a driver-assistance system, not an autonomous driving system. You are still responsible for the vehicle’s safety. Keep your feet near the pedals and be ready to intervene at any moment.
  • Clear Obstacles: Ensure there are no unexpected temporary obstacles like shopping carts, stray animals, or children that the sensors or cameras might miss or misinterpret.
  • Understand System Limitations: The system can be affected by poor weather conditions (heavy rain, snow, fog), a dirty sensor or camera lens, or unusual parking space markings.
  • Know When to Manual Park: For extremely tight spots, unusual angles, or if you simply prefer manual control, don’t hesitate to switch off the system and park the traditional way.

Maintenance and Care for Parking Sensors and Cameras

Your CLA’s parking assist systems are robust, but maintaining them is key to their reliable performance. Here’s how to keep your sensors and cameras in top condition:

Keeping Sensors Clean

The ultrasonic sensors embedded in your bumpers can become obstructed by dirt, mud, ice, or even thick layers of wax. A simple wash with car soap and water is usually sufficient. If they seem to be malfunctioning, check them for any visible debris. Avoid using abrasive cleaners or high-pressure washers directly on the sensors, as this could cause damage.

Caring for Cameras

The lenses of your rearview and surround-view cameras are exposed to the elements. Grit, dust, and water spots can impair their clarity. Gently wipe the camera lenses with a soft, lint-free microfiber cloth. For tougher grime, a damp cloth with a mild, non-abrasive cleaner (like glass cleaner) or a dedicated automotive lens cleaner can be used. Regularly check the camera lenses for cracks or damage, which would require professional replacement.

Checking for Damage

Periodically inspect your bumpers and the areas around the sensors and cameras for any signs of physical damage, such as cracks or deep scratches. Even minor impacts can misalign sensors or damage camera mounts, affecting their accuracy. If you suspect any damage, it’s best to have it inspected by a Mercedes-Benz service center.

System Recalibration

In rare cases, after significant bodywork (e.g., replacing a bumper) or if there’s a persistent issue, the parking assist system might require recalibration. This is a specialized procedure that should only be performed by qualified technicians using Mercedes-Benz diagnostic equipment. If your parking assist system shows erratic behavior or warning lights, consult your dealership.
